Unveiling the Legacy of CS Osborne & Co.
Founded in 1826 by Charles Samuel Osborne and his brother Henry, CS Osborne & Co. has been a beacon of excellence in tool manufacturing for over two centuries. From its humble beginnings serving harness makers and saddlers to becoming a global leader in the industry, the company’s legacy is a testament to innovation and quality.

Fun Facts About Sumner County, TN
- County Seat: Gallatin
- Year Established: 1786
- Formed from: Davidson County
- Etymology: Jethro Sumner (1733–1785), an American colonist who defended North Carolinaagainst the British in 1780.
- Time Zone: America/Chicago
- Population: 166123
- Land Area Sq Km: 1370
- Land Area Sq Mi: 529
- Density: 246
